West Noble Schools announce food plans

LIGONIER – All students, age 0 through grade 12, are eligible to receive free meals while West Noble Schools are closed due to the Coronavirus/COVID-19.
The program starts Wednesday, March 25 and runs each Wednesday through April 22 including Spring Break. It will be a drive-through with staff handing out the bags.
Each bag will contain 5 breakfasts and 5 lunches. Parents should check the bags as some products will need to be refrigerated. Also, if your child has a peanut allergy, check the bag before serving your student.
You may pick up meals at either site, not both. Children need to be present.
· 11:00 am – 1:00 pm – West Noble Primary / Front Drive
· 5:00 pm – 7:00 pm – West Noble High School / Front Staff Parking Lot
